Description
The Istanbul Agop 13" Xist Hi-Hat cymbals bring together the timeless artistry of Turkish cymbal-making with a modern touch. Carefully crafted from B20 alloy, these hi-hats deliver a crisp, articulate response that is perfect for both studio sessions and live performances. The Xist series is designed for musicians seeking the rich, complex tones typically found in high-end cymbals, yet at an accessible price point.
Each cymbal is hand-finished, ensuring a unique character and consistency that only Istanbul Agop can provide. The 13" size offers a quick, bright sound that cuts through in any mix, making it an excellent choice for genres ranging from jazz to rock. Whether you're laying down intricate patterns or driving a solid groove, these hi-hats provide a defined stick presence and a versatile tonal range.
Perfect for both budding drummers and seasoned professionals, the Istanbul Agop 13" Xist Hi-Hat cymbals are a testament to the fusion of tradition and innovation. Their modern, projecting sound profile makes them a staple tool in any drummer's arsenal.

FAQs
-
What styles of music is the Istanbul Agop 13" Xist Hi-Hat best suited for?
-
The Istanbul Agop 13" Xist Hi-Hat is versatile and works well for a variety of music styles, including jazz, funk, and pop, due to its crisp, articulate sound and quick response.
-
How does the sound of a 13" hi-hat compare to larger sizes?
-
A 13" hi-hat like the Istanbul Agop Xist typically offers a tighter, more focused sound with faster articulation compared to larger sizes, making it ideal for intricate patterns and faster playing.
-
What material is the Istanbul Agop 13" Xist Hi-Hat made from?
-
The Istanbul Agop 13" Xist Hi-Hat is crafted from B20 bronze, known for its durability and rich, complex tonal characteristics.
-
Are these hi-hats suitable for live performances?
-
Yes, the Istanbul Agop 13" Xist Hi-Hat is well-suited for live performances, providing a bright, cutting sound that projects well in various acoustic environments.
-
How does the Istanbul Agop 13" Xist Hi-Hat pair compare to other models in the Xist series?
-
The 13" Xist Hi-Hat offers a faster response and tighter sound compared to larger models in the Xist series, making it a great choice for drummers seeking precision and clarity.

Owner Insights
We analyzed real musician discussions from forums and Reddit to find what players love, question, and tweak about Istanbul Agop 13" Xist Hi-Hat (Pair).
Comparisons
-
The 14" Xist hi-hats are noted to be brighter, while 15" pairs may offer a darker tone.
Source -
The 13" dry dark hats were described as flat and lifeless compared to the more musical and versatile SR2 Thin or thin/paperthin old A’s.
Source -
The 13" Xist Dry Dark hats are praised for their unique sound, distinct from more common hi-hat models.
Source
